Embeth Davidtz stars in "The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o" (2011), opposite Daniel Craig, Rooney Mara and Stellan Skarsgård, as Annika Blomkvist. Davidtz is also set to star as Mary Jane in "The Amazing Spider-Man" (2012), opposite Andrew Garfield and Emma Stone.

Constantly delivering poignant and critically applauded performances, Embeth Davidtz caught the attention of the world for her genuine and confident portrayal as the Jewish maid who survives both the abuse and attraction of Ralph Fienne's sadistic commander Goeth in Steven Spielberg's "Schindler's List." People who saw her work recognized the future was promising for an actress whose talent seemed unstoppable. Davidtz has delivered on that promise.
Embeth was seen on the big screen starring in "Fragments," with Kate Beckinsale, Forest Whitaker and Guy Pearce, "Fracture," alongside Anthony Hopkins, Ryan Gosling and David Strathairn, and the critically acclaimed "Junebug," opposite Amy Adams and Alessandro Nivola. Released by Sony Classics, "Junebug" premiered to rave reviews at the 2005 Sundance Film Festival. The drama tells the tale of a dealer in "outsider" art who travels from Chicago to North Carolina to meet her new in-laws, and upon arrival, challenges the equilibrium of the middle class Southern home.
Previous film credits include the highly successful "Bridget Jones Diary," opposite Hugh Grant and Renee Zellweger, "The Palace Thief," with Kevin Kline and Patrick Dempsey, Nick Hamm's independent film, "The Hole," the thriller "13 Ghosts," Miramax's "Mansfield Park," Disney's "Bicentennial Man," Robert Altman's critically acclaimed thriller "The Gingerbread Man," "Murder in the First," opposite Kevin Bacon, "Feast of July," "Matilda" and the supernatural thriller "Fallen," opposite Denzel Washington.
In addition to her film work, Davidtz made her debut as a season regular on CBS's "Citizen Baines," created by John Wells. The drama focused on a prominent three-term US senator (James Cromwell) returning to his Seattle home to join his family following a shocking loss in his bid for re-election. Davidtz portrayed his daughter who aspired to follow in her father's footsteps as a future congresswoman.
